Non-College Work-Study | GSI, Student Success Ambassador (Finance) Department:
Gator Success Institute Salary:
$15.00 per hour Description:
Student Success Ambassadors serve as campus representatives for the Gator Success Institute and 3SL, helping promote educational resources and services to fellow students. The role blends administrative duties and student engagement with flexible hours and professional development opportunities. Key Responsibilities Build partnerships with student groups and campus organizations Participate in departmental marketing activities (tabling, flyers, fairs, etc.) Share branded content through social media Represent the institution at campus events and activities
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ities
Active in campus life (student orgs, clubs, or leadership roles) Self-starter able to manage multiple priorities Passion for helping peers achieve academic and career goals
Benefits
$14/hour starting wage with flexible hours (10-20 hours/week) Resume-building for marketing, sales, and higher education professionals
Qualifications
Currently enrolled UHD sophomore, junior, senior, or Graduate Student
